阅读:1848回复:3
用TDI Filter统计网络流量的问题
我写了个Tdi Filter用来统计80端口的数据流量。其中我拦截了
TDI_EVENT_RECEIVE,用我的ReceiveHandler代替了原来的 我下载了一个5M多的软件,但是我在ReceiveHandler只统计到了3M多的数据。后来我把TDI_RECEIVE里面的数据也加了进去但是还差1M多。 我想问一下TDI还有可能在那些地方收数据? 并且我也没有发现EventReceiveExpedited, ClientEventChainedReceive等被调用过 |
|
最新喜欢:![]() |
沙发#
发布于:2003-09-21 15:58
我也Hook了这两个函数,但是没有发现被调用过。
用TDIMon也没有发现有这两个事件被调用 |
|
板凳#
发布于:2003-09-18 17:49
你怎么发现
EventReceiveExpedited ClientEventChainedReceive 没有被调用呢?? 你用tdimon看看, 有没有相关的tdi 事件被调用 |
|
地板#
发布于:2003-09-18 10:30
没有人做过这种网络流量统计的东东吗?
|
|